The New York State Gaming Facility Location Board is expected to announce its decision on awarding up to three new casino licenses by December.
This market will resolve to "Yes" if the listed project is officially granted a license by February 28, 2026, 11:59 PM ET. Otherwise, it will resolve to "No".
An announcement alone will not count as a "Yes" resolution; only the issuance of an official license will qualify.
This market will resolve to "No" if the granting of such a license becomes impossible for a listed project, for example, if the application is officially declined.
The primary resolution source for this market will be official information from the New York State Gaming Facility Location Board or another official representative of the State of New York; however, a consensus of credible reporting will also be used.
